Well I got assaulted in a bar (jacka$$ threw a beer bottle at my face) and I did nothing to provoke him. It'* a long story, but anyways, I was looking into small claims court for my medical bills, and at least here in NY, it only costs $15 to file a claim in small claims court if you're suing for up to $1000. Over that it'* more, but still cheap.

I wouldn't hesitate to get back any money you payed out of pocket. I watch (used to anyways) court shows all the time, so you just need to prove your case and bring all the appropriate paperwork. In my case, I could have easily sued him in small claims court and won. But his criminal case is pending and the court will get my money from him through his trial.
